Hydrea: A Medication for Cancer Treatment

Hydrea, also known as hydroxyurea, is a widely used medication for treating various types of cancer. It falls under the antimetabolites class of drugs, which function by interfering with the growth and reproduction of cancer cells.

Here are some key points about Hydrea:

  1. Hydrea is commonly prescribed for leukemia, melanoma, and certain types of solid tumors.
  2. As an antimetabolite, it disrupts the proliferation of cancer cells.

Hydrea can be administered in combination with other therapies or used alone, depending on the type and stage of cancer. It is important for patients to consult their healthcare provider to determine the appropriate treatment approach.

Options for cancer treatment

When it comes to the treatment of cancer, there are several options available depending on the type and stage of the disease. These options can be used alone or in combination with each other to effectively combat cancer cells. Here are some common treatment options:

1. Surgery

Surgery involves the removal of cancerous tumors or tissues from the body. It is often the first line of treatment for solid tumors that are localized and can be completely removed. In some cases, surgery may be followed by additional treatments such as chemotherapy or radiation therapy to target any remaining cancer cells.

2. Radiation therapy

Radiation therapy uses high-energy X-rays or other types of radiation to target and kill cancer cells. It can be delivered externally through a machine called a linear accelerator or internally through radioactive materials placed directly into or near the tumor. Radiation therapy is frequently used to shrink tumors, alleviate symptoms, and prevent cancer recurrence after surgery.

3. Immunotherapy

Immunotherapy, also known as biologic therapy, involves the use of medications or substances that stimulate the body’s immune system to recognize and destroy cancer cells. This treatment approach may be used to treat various types of cancer, including melanoma, lung cancer, and kidney cancer. Immunotherapy can be administered through injections, infusions, or oral medications and can have fewer side effects compared to traditional chemotherapy.

4. Targeted therapy

Targeted therapy involves the use of drugs or other substances that specifically target certain molecules or genetic abnormalities in cancer cells. Unlike chemotherapy, which affects both cancerous and healthy cells, targeted therapy is designed to attack cancer cells while minimizing damage to healthy tissues. This treatment option is often used to treat cancers that have specific genetic mutations, such as breast cancer and lung cancer.

It is important to note that the choice of treatment for cancer will vary depending on factors such as the type and stage of cancer, the patient’s overall health, and their individual preferences. It is best to consult with a healthcare professional to determine the most appropriate treatment plan.

5. Safety considerations and precautions:

Before purchasing and using Hydrea, it is important to be aware of safety considerations and precautions to ensure its safe and effective use. Here are some important points to keep in mind:

5.1. Contraindications:

– Hydrea should not be used in individuals who are allergic to hydroxyurea or any of its ingredients.

– It should not be used in patients with severe bone marrow suppression, a history of severe allergic reactions, or severe kidney or liver problems.

5.2. Side effects:

– Like all medications, Hydrea can cause side effects. Common side effects may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, loss of appetite, mouth sores, and hair loss.

– Serious side effects, although rare, may include bone marrow suppression, which can lead to low blood cell counts and increase the risk of infections or bleeding.

– It is important to consult with a healthcare professional if you experience any concerning or persistent side effects.

5.3. Drug interactions:

– Hydrea may interact with other medications, including certain chemotherapy drugs, antiretroviral drugs used to treat HIV/AIDS, and medications that affect the immune system.

– It is important to inform your healthcare provider about all medications, supplements, and herbal products you are taking before starting Hydrea.

5.4. Pregnancy and breastfeeding:

– Hydrea can cause harm to a developing fetus and should not be used during pregnancy unless the potential benefits outweigh the risks.

– It is essential to discuss the potential risks and benefits with a healthcare professional if you are pregnant or planning to become pregnant.

– Hydrea may also pass into breast milk, and its use should be avoided while breastfeeding.

5.5. Monitoring and follow-up:

– Regular monitoring of blood counts and liver and kidney function may be necessary while taking Hydrea.

– It is important to attend all scheduled appointments and follow your healthcare provider’s instructions for monitoring and follow-up.

By knowing and understanding these safety considerations and precautions, individuals can take appropriate measures to ensure the safe and effective use of Hydrea for their cancer treatment.

6. Precautions and potential side effects of Hydrea:

While Hydrea can be an effective treatment option for cancer, it is important to be aware of the potential precautions and side effects associated with the medication. Before starting Hydrea, patients should inform their healthcare provider about any existing medical conditions, allergies, or medications they are currently taking.

Precautions:

There are certain precautions that should be taken into consideration when using Hydrea. These include:

  • Pregnancy and breastfeeding: Hydrea may cause harm to unborn babies and should not be used during pregnancy. It is important to discuss the risks and benefits with a healthcare provider. It is also recommended to avoid breastfeeding while taking Hydrea.
  • Blood disorders: Hydrea can affect blood cell counts, so regular blood tests may be required to monitor for any potential abnormalities.
  • Liver or kidney problems: Patients with liver or kidney problems may require adjustments to their dosage or additional monitoring while taking Hydrea.
  • Previous or current infections: Hydrea can lower the body’s immune response and increase the risk of infections. It is important to avoid contact with individuals who have contagious illnesses while taking Hydrea.

Side Effects:

Common side effects of Hydrea may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, mouth sores, loss of appetite, drowsiness, and skin rash. These side effects are usually mild and can be managed with the help of a healthcare provider.

Less common, but potentially serious side effects of Hydrea include blood disorders such as anemia, leukopenia, and thrombocytopenia. Signs of these conditions may include unexplained anemia, persistent fever, unusual bruising or bleeding, and severe fatigue. If any of these symptoms occur, it is important to seek medical attention immediately.

Hydrea may also increase the risk of developing secondary cancers, such as acute myeloid leukemia or skin cancer. Regular monitoring and follow-up with a healthcare provider are necessary to detect and manage any potential complications.

It is important to note that this is not an exhaustive list of precautions and side effects associated with Hydrea. Patients should consult with their healthcare provider for a comprehensive understanding of the potential risks and benefits of using this medication.

7. Possible side effects of Hydrea

While Hydrea can be an effective medication for treating cancer, it is important to be aware of the possible side effects that may occur with its use. Here are some of the potential side effects of Hydrea:

1. Hematological side effects:

  • Bone marrow suppression: Hydrea can cause a decrease in the production of blood cells in the bone marrow, leading to low levels of red blood cells, white blood cells, and platelets. This can increase the risk of anemia, infections, and bleeding problems.
  • Anemia: Hydrea may cause a decrease in red blood cell count, leading to fatigue, shortness of breath, and weakness.
  • Leukopenia: This is a reduction in the number of white blood cells, which can increase the risk of infections.
  • Thrombocytopenia: Hydrea can lower the platelet count, which can lead to an increased risk of bleeding.

2. Dermatological side effects:

  • Skin rash: Some individuals may develop a rash or skin irritation while taking Hydrea. This side effect is usually mild and may resolve on its own.
  • Skin darkening: Long-term use of Hydrea may cause skin darkening or hyperpigmentation, especially in areas exposed to the sun.

3. Gastrointestinal side effects:

  • Nausea and vomiting: Hydrea can cause nausea and vomiting, although these side effects can often be managed with anti-nausea medications.
  • Diarrhea: Some individuals may experience diarrhea while taking Hydrea. It is important to stay hydrated and inform your healthcare provider if the diarrhea persists or becomes severe.

4. Other side effects:

  • Fever: Hydrea may cause a low-grade fever, which is usually not a cause for concern.
  • Headache: Some individuals may experience headaches while taking Hydrea.
  • Reproductive side effects: Hydrea may cause temporary or permanent infertility in both males and females. It is important to discuss fertility preservation options with your healthcare provider before starting treatment.

It is important to note that not all individuals will experience these side effects, and some may experience different or additional side effects not listed here. If you are experiencing any concerning or severe side effects while taking Hydrea, it is important to contact your healthcare provider for further guidance.
